首页> 中文学位 >社会物联网中信任分析与关键节点搜索算法研究
【6h】

社会物联网中信任分析与关键节点搜索算法研究

代理获取

摘要

社会物联网的起源是将社会网络的概念整合应用到物联网的解决方案之中。物联网从最初的实体交互演变为加入人的智能交互。人的加入,让物联网结合了社会网络的性质。人与人、人与物、物与物的交互关系让社会物联网的节点交互方式相对于社会网络或物联网来说都更加的复杂。由于自由交互、开放式的网络环境特征,导致用户在网络中选择要交互的目标节点会面临许多的风险,恶意节点的攻击或虚假信息及欺诈行为等都会损害节点的利益。因此需要制定信任评价机制来抑制这些恶意行为,保障更加安全的网络环境。信任是社交网络和物联网中的关键问题。所以社会物联网中的信任问题也值得认真研究。 在社会物联网中,节点扮演两种角色,分别是委托人与受托人。委托人指派发任务的节点。受托人指的是接受并执行任务的节点。当委托人评估受托人是否值得信任时,有很大的可能存在完全陌生或者没有交互经验的受托人。但是由于信任可以通过节点传递,所以,选择委托人和受托人共同信任的中间节点,在委托人和受托人之间传递信任,就能够为任务找到合适的受托人。但在信任传递过程中,传递路径的选择有多种,可以通过组合不同的中间节点来形成不同的传递路径。但在这些信任传递路径中,只有少数中间节点是能够显著影响信任传递性的关键节点。如果移除这部分关键节点则委托人就找不到合适的受托人来执行任务,受托人也不再能够提供服务。所以在一个社会物联网中找到哪些节点是关键节点至关重要。据所知,目前还没有在信任传递网络中提取关键节点的算法。为了搜索到这部分关键节点,本文首先分析总结了信任的特征,并重新定义了信任的概念,确定了信任包含的六个组成部分:委托人、受托人、目标、可信赖度、行为模式以及上下文。同时基于信任的概念规范了信任的传递性这一重要性质,确定了信任被传递的条件。然后本文以重定义的信任概念为基础,提出了关键节点搜索算法(KNS算法)。文中借助伪代码及流程图的方式展示算法的搜索原理,并模拟一个社交网络实例,剖析了KNS算法在其中搜索关键节点的每一步骤。最后,采用3组真实的社交网络数据集对KNS算法进行验证,实验结果证明该算法可以在有向、加权和非完全连接的物联网(loT)网络中找到每个节点的所有关键节点。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号